Is Makka Pakka dead? Theories on the surreal In The Night Garden’s meaning continue to dominate the internet.
In 2017, a Mirror article read, “Iggle Piggle’s dead and Mr Tumble’s a murderer – read this and you’ll never see CBeebies the same way again.”
The piece details all the ways that children’s channel CBeebies is filled with disturbing tales. One of the shows featured in the article is In The Night Garden.
The show has always been noted for its surreal colours and eerie characters, but the article in The Mirror adds a whole new horrifying dimension. According to their theory, Iggle Piggle, one of the main characters of In The Night Garden, is “plainly representing the consciousness of a child in a morphine-induced dream state on the operating table as his life slips away.”

Is Makka Pakka dead?
Makka Pakka wasn’t addressed in the original article detailing the hidden theories behind children’s shows. That hasn’t stopped (mostly adult) viewers of In The Night Garden speculating on what happened to Makka Pakka.
One Twitter user wrote: “I have a subtext theory for Night Garden. Iggle Piggle is a dead sailor, hence why he is blue and starts on a boat adrift. The Night Garden is some sort of purgatory, hence why it is night but always light. Makka Pakka goes round preparing the dead and cleaning”
Another wrote: “But Iggle Piggle is already dead and the whole Night Garden is his dying hallucination as he drifts at sea with no provisions so Makka Pakka is just a hallucination.”
In the CBeebies show, none of the characters are actually dead. However, if we are to view In The Night Garden as some dream state between the worlds of the living and the dead, or even purgatory, then it could be argued that Makka Pakka is also dead.

Is Justyn Towler dead?
No, Justyn Towler is not dead.
Justyn Towler played Makka Pakka in In The Night Garden from 2007 to 2009. Before this, Towler had starred in Noah’s Ark (1998), Brum (2002), and The Marchioness Disaster (2007).
After the series ended, Towler became a pastor. He has worked at the Renewal Christian Centre since 2011.
